AMOSIN systems and scanning heads
Linear or angle measurement, absolute or incremental output and the mounting arrangement determine the configuration. Family names help identify requirements; compatibility is checked against complete markings and documentation.
LMK 1010 / 1005
Compact open incremental linear scanning heads for limited installation space. Signal processing is housed in an external connector module, with 1 Vpp or TTL (RS 422) output options.

Open incremental linear scanning heads with integrated electronics. Unlike the miniature LMK 1010/1005 family, signal processing is built into the head. Versions include 1 Vpp and TTL (RS 422) outputs.

A scanning head for guided incremental linear systems, fitted with wipers. Optional spring mounting accommodates larger installation tolerances, including long measuring axes and retrofit applications.

Absolute linear systems pair an LMKA scanning head with an LMBA measuring tape. The family offers EnDat 2.2, DRIVE-CLiQ, Fanuc, Mitsubishi, SSI + 1 Vpp and BiSS/C options; the required interface is configuration-specific.

Absolute angle systems combine a WMKA scanning head with a WMFA measuring flange or WMRA ring. External or internal scanning is selected to suit rotary tables, rotary axes or direct drives.

Incremental angle systems use measuring rings or flanges and scanning heads with external or integrated electronics. Output options include 1 Vpp and TTL (RS 422), with designs for external and internal scanning.

A modular encoder with a 1 Vpp output for main spindles in turning and milling machines. It combines a scanning head and measuring ring, records operating data and supports offline readout and diagnostics using STU-60 and AMO-Check.

Parts for an installed system
To replace a scanning head, measuring tape, ring or flange, provide the complete designations of both system components. Include photos of markings, connector and installation. For heads with external electronics, identify the electronic module as well. Similar family names do not establish interchangeability.
